Output d89afd63e439a855eabae7de54a55a224ac53c583a7078cd6518861810640d30:0

value
3750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 155b7cf19da217a960fbed8c307a8e098db325df OP_EQUALVERIFY OP_CHECKSIG
address
12wvnjN6t2fZR5SXR5u9NeudVeD63JPzRi
transaction
d89afd63e439a855eabae7de54a55a224ac53c583a7078cd6518861810640d30
spent
true